Guidelines for submitting articles to the LANDviews online journal

We are always looking for new and exciting projects, information, and dialogue to post on our website. In order to make this process as efficient and accurate as possible, here are some guidelines for your submission.

Please submit a brief abstract of your article to submissions@landviews.org. We will review your abstract and contact you directly about further options. If your proposal is accepted, please follow the guidelines below in submitting your article. Incomplete submissions will not be accepted. The editors of LAND may take the liberty of making minor deletions or corrections if necessary, without contacting the contributor. However, we ask that you submit your article finished and ready to go!

  1. Article length: between 500 and 1000 words. Please include a title.
  2. Images: 3-6 images. Each image should be accompanied by a caption including, title, location, date and if applicable, photo credit(s). If you are familiar with formatting images for the web, please size images to 340 pixels wide and save as JPEG format (panoramic photos may be sized to 690 pixels wide). Otherwise we will be happy to process your high-res image files into the appropriate format. Please note that our server will not accept email attachments over 10MB in size. You may send multiple messages with separate attachments, if necessary, but make sure that each one is properly identified. If you have any questions, please contact our webmaster.
  3. Artist/designer’s biography: approximately 100 words.
  4. Writer’s biography (if other than artist/designer), same as above.
  5. Contact information should be included as you would like it presented, e.g. email, website, mailing address, etc. We will include these items at the end of your text.
  6. Send text & images via email to submissions@landviews.org
